major update: lot of bugfixes, lot of changes
- let compiler handle stack pointer arithmetic: switch to 16bit - improve update(): deadline depends on incremental release - resolve timing issues, new time convertion macros - major simplification of scheduler, most of garbage removed - new overflow interrupt for cycle counter, resolves also timing problems - simplify pwm generation, lookup tables are deferred, switch to 4bit - add blocking on shared values - remove garbage in lcd module and some bugfixes - add alternative reboot command to uart command interpreter - KISS
